Core Innovation

This paper introduces TrajSurv, which uses neural controlled differential equations to model continuous latent trajectories from irregular EHR data. It uniquely aligns latent states with clinical progression through time-aware contrastive learning and offers transparent survival outcome interpretation via vector field explanation and trajectory clustering. This approach improves both prediction accuracy and model interpretability over prior deep learning methods.
